Shoury Priyanshu - PeerSpot reviewer
Facilitates seamless data aggregation with some outdated visual elements hindering user appeal
Real-time data integration is an area for improvement. Although I've worked on several solutions involving real-time integration, it's not very user-friendly and often lags, especially with over a million data rows. This makes Power BI difficult to manage as loading times can reach one or two minutes, which is problematic today. There are challenges with scalability, requiring multiple pages in dashboards to manage these issues. Visualization could be improved as it appears outdated. Users, especially newcomers, find it unappealing and not user-friendly.
JohanSkibdahl - PeerSpot reviewer
Automating customer support with advanced AI capabilities and seamless communication
Zendesk has been invaluable in automating communications such as email and phone calls. It allows us to handle more support cases with fewer people due to its advanced artificial intelligence capabilities. This intelligent tool can manage complex queries before users even realize they are interacting with a non-human. Additionally, we have integrated Zendesk with Datto and Klaviyo, enhancing our workflows.
Nadeem Asghar - PeerSpot reviewer
Experience with advanced analytics and visualization features boosts decision making
I think the team would know how to predict what needs to be improved. Every business has its own predictions, so providing specific fields based on which to calculate predictions would be helpful. The analytics plans are very complex because they depend on the users, while other Zoho plans operate on a per-user basis. The analytics plan has different features for one user, 10 users, and 25 users. Having to pay for 25 users when only 11 are needed creates an issue with the pricing structure.
